INEQUALITIES

Which of the following linear inequalities best represents: The cost of an apple (a) is greater than the cost of a banana (b)?

A. a = b

B. a > b

C. a < b

D. a > b

The answer is letter B and D. a > b

When we say greater than in an inequality, we are saying that the first object has more value to the other which means we use the greater than symbol.

a is greater than b, so it represents a > b.
